Web2 Jul 2024 · 808 Silicone spray for automotive use. Silicone spray can be used on various parts of a vehicle. For example, CRC 808 silicone can be used to lubricate door locks, hinges, linkages, window guides, and bushes. Web1 Feb 2024 · The first step is to measure out 3 parts distilled white vinegar and 1 part tap water. Next, pour the measured amounts of vinegar and water into the empty spray bottle. Then, spray the solution on the frozen lock and wait 5 minutes. Finally, try to put the key in the lock.
